    DEPARTMENT OF HOUSING AND URBAN DEVELOPMENT
    
    [Docket No. FR-4356-N-12]
    
    
    Notice of Proposed Information Collection: Comment Request
    
    AGENCY: Office of the Assistant Secretary for Housing, HUD.
    
    ACTION: Notice.
    
    -----------------------------------------------------------------------
    
    SUMMARY: The proposed information collection requirement described 
    below will be submitted to the Office of Management and Budget (OMB) 
    for review, as required by the Paperwork Reduction Act. The Department 
    is soliciting public comments on the subject proposal.

    S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: The Department is submitting the proposed 
    information collection to OMB for review, as required by the Paperwork 
    Reduction Act of 1995 (44 U.S.C. chapter 35, as amended).
        This Notice is soliciting comments from members of the public and 
    affecting agencies concerning the proposed collection of information 
    to: (1) Evaluate whether the proposed of information is necessary for 
    the proper performance of the functions of the agency, including 
    whether the information will have practical utility; (2) Evaluate the 
    accuracy of the agency's estimate of the burden of the proposed 
    collection of information; (3) Enhance the quality, utility, and 
    clarity of the information to be collected; and (4) Minimize the burden 
    of the collection of information on those who are to respond; including 
    through the use of appropriate automated collection techniques or other 
    forms of information technology, e.g., permitting electronic submission 
    of responses.
        This Notice also lists the following information:
        Title of Proposal: Title I Financial Statement.
        OMB Control Number, if applicable: 2502-0098.
        Description of the need for the information and proposed use: The 
    form is used by HUD to obtain information about a debtor's ability to 
    pay the debt in full, pay in installments and/or compromise the debt. 
    Failure to collect this information would result in uneducated 
    decisions in respect to the handling of debtor's accounts.
        Agency form numbers, if applicable: HUD-56142.
        Members of affected public: Individuals.
        Estimation of the total numbers of hours needed to prepare the 
    information collection including number of respondents, frequency of 
    response, and hours of response:
        Number of Respondents: 1,258.
        Frequency of Response: On occasion.
        Total hours of response requested: 1.
        Status of the proposed information collection: Extension of a 
    currently approved collection.
